Which of the following is not a characteristic of islands in Southeast Asia?

Geography
2 answers:
Fofino [41]3 years ago
6 0

D. Many are primarily deserts.

Explanation:

Many of the islands in South east Asia are not primarily deserts. South east Asia is a region of the world located in the Southern part of China to the East of India and north western part of Australia.

  • The region is rife with series of tectonic activities and most Islands here fall on the Ring of fire.
  • Many of the Islands here Volcanic Islands rising and towering above the ocean floor.
  • The predominant climate here is the luxuriant tropical rainforest with wet and dry seasons all year round.
  • None of the Islands are deserts.

Explain why having a primate city can negatively affect the economic development of a country. ​
marin [14]

The way that a primate city can negatively affect development of a country is the fact that there is an unequal distribution of resources, wealth and power in the city.

<h3>What is a primate city?</h3>

This is a city that is known to be the dominant city in a country compared t other cities or towns that may be around it.

In such ciities, most of the investments and resources are focused there and other places are left out.
